Porto Alegre
   
There's a joke in Brazil that the No. 1 sport is volleyball -- because football isn't a sport, but a religion.
   
In which case, is perhaps the Brazilian football equivalent of the Vatican or the Potala Palace. The most southern of the 12 World Cup venues has two major teams -- Gremio and Internacional -- and their cross-town rivalry is the most intense in all Brazil.
   
Internacional vice-president Diana de Oliveira says, apparently in all seriousness, that she never writes in blue pen, because blue is Gremio's color. The idea that she could have children who would support Gremio is unthinkable.
   
Her husband is an Internacional supporter, although she says that's not the only reason she married him.
   
he city of 1.4 million people is hosting four group games -- France-Honduras, Netherlands-Australia, South Korea-Algeria, Argentina-Nigeria -- as well as the last 16 knockout game between the winner of Group G, likely to be Germany, and the runner-up from Group H.
